About the Moncton University
The University of Moncton was founded in 1963 and has become a center for higher education in New Brunswick, Canada. Home to more than 5,000 students, the university is known for its programs in both French and English. It actively collaborates with various universities and organizations around the world. The university's educational philosophy is based on the principles of multilingualism, inclusivity, and social responsibility. Unique teaching methods include problem-based projects and close collaboration with the local community. The university actively promotes education in the region by offering programs and resources that support students' personal and professional development. With its reputation and quality of education, it has become one of the leading universities in Canada. The institution's main goals are to develop students' critical thinking, prepare them for higher education, and encourage their active participation in community life.

Admission conditions in Moncton University
To apply to the University of Moncton, applicants must prepare all necessary documents and go through a selection process. Requirements may vary depending on the program and level of study. Mandatory exams: TOEFL or IELTS for international students. Minimum age: 17 years old. Application process: Applications are submitted through the university's official website. The application fee varies by program and is approximately 100 CAD. Educational qualifications: A diploma of secondary education or its equivalent is required. Required documents: Application, exam results, recommendation letters, resume. Requirements for international students: Minimum level of English proficiency, successful completion of an interview. Financial conditions: Proof of funds for education and living expenses is required. Application deadlines: Main deadlines are from January to March each year. Testing or interview: An interview may be conducted depending on the program. Qualifications or experience: The program may require specific experience or prior education. Notification of results: Decisions are made within 4-6 weeks after the application is submitted.
